will this code work (bapi)

Former Member
0 Likes
657

hi to all experts,

my requirement is to delete the purchase requisitions line items if they are not converted to PO

i have used bapi_requisition_delete to delete the pr

here is my code will this work any inputs will be appreciated ......

this inside an implicit enhancement in the FM FM_CO_ASS_INPUT_GET_PM im matching the order number (AUFNR) and getting the pr and item no and (statu not equal to B it is not converted to PO)

im deleting using BAPI

SELECT banfn bnfpo FROM ebkn INTO TABLE it_ebkn
            WHERE aufnr EQ i_aufnr.
IF it_ebkn IS NOT INITIAL.
SELECT banfn bnfpo from eban INTO TABLE it_eban
    FOR ALL ENTRIES IN it_ebkn
  WHERE banfn eq it_ebkn-banfn
    AND statu NE 'B'.
ENDIF.

LOOP AT it_eban INTO wa_eban.
  MOVE: wa_eban-bnfpo TO it_del-PREQ_ITEM,
        'X'           TO it_del-DELETE_IND,
        'X'           TO it_del-CLOSED.
  APPEND it_del.
  CLEAR  it_del.


CALL FUNCTION 'BAPI_REQUISITION_DELETE'
  EXPORTING
    number                            = wa_eban-banfn
 tables
    requisition_items_to_delete       = it_del
   RETURN                            =  it_return
          .


CLEAR : wa_eban.

Hello,

You need a BAPI_TRANSACTION_COMMIT after the BAPI's successful return.
